[rtems-libbsd commit] Do not set mulitcast hostname in sethostname()

Sebastian Huber sebh at rtems.org
Thu Nov 20 14:24:00 UTC 2014


Module:    rtems-libbsd
Branch:    master
Commit:    4153ebe419da8223de815cde3a9317cea0d9f08f
Changeset: http://git.rtems.org/rtems-libbsd/commit/?id=4153ebe419da8223de815cde3a9317cea0d9f08f

Author:    Sebastian Huber <sebastian.huber at embedded-brains.de>
Date:      Mon Nov 10 08:26:15 2014 +0100

Do not set mulitcast hostname in sethostname()

---

 freebsd/sys/kern/kern_mib.c | 7 -------
 1 file changed, 7 deletions(-)

diff --git a/freebsd/sys/kern/kern_mib.c b/freebsd/sys/kern/kern_mib.c
index a1430f9..8d19a3b 100644
--- a/freebsd/sys/kern/kern_mib.c
+++ b/freebsd/sys/kern/kern_mib.c
@@ -56,9 +56,6 @@ __FBSDID("$FreeBSD$");
 #include <sys/smp.h>
 #include <sys/sx.h>
 #include <rtems/bsd/sys/unistd.h>
-#ifdef __rtems__
-#include <rtems/mdns.h>
-#endif /* __rtems__ */
 
 SYSCTL_NODE(, 0,	  sysctl, CTLFLAG_RW, 0,
 	"Sysctl internal magic");
@@ -329,10 +326,6 @@ sysctl_hostname(SYSCTL_HANDLER_ARGS)
 #else /* __rtems__ */
 		(void) cpr;
 		(void) descend;
-
-		if (pr_offset == offsetof(struct prison, pr_hostname)) {
-			rtems_mdns_sethostname(tmpname);
-		}
 #endif /* __rtems__ */
 		mtx_unlock(&pr->pr_mtx);
 #ifndef __rtems__




More information about the vc mailing list